#a1585d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a1585d is composed of 63.1% red, 34.5%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.3% magenta, 42.2%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 355.9 degrees, a saturation of 29.3% and a lightness of 48.8%. #a1585d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b0ba with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#a1585d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a1585d has RGB values of R:161, G:88,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.42,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10573917.

Hex triplet a1585d #a1585d
RGB Decimal 161, 88, 93 rgb(161,88,93)
RGB Percent 63.1, 34.5, 36.5 rgb(63.1%,34.5%,36.5%)
CMYK 0, 45, 42, 37
HSL 355.9°, 29.3, 48.8 hsl(355.9,29.3%,48.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 355.9°, 45.3, 63.1
Web Safe 996666 #996666
CIE-LAB 46.108, 30.499, 10.516
XYZ 20.164, 15.348, 12.256
xyY 0.422, 0.321, 15.348
CIE-LCH 46.108, 32.261, 19.023
CIE-LUV 46.108, 49.771, 7.617
Hunter-Lab 39.177, 23.312, 8.876
Binary 10100001, 01011000, 01011101

Shades and Tints of #a1585d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090505 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fb is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#a1585d is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#6e6e6e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#786a6b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#78746e Protanopia 1% of men
  • #867061 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a66066 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#876a68 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#90675f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a45d63 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
